Output e07ef14e183b3017a6491b064fe64ece186ebe1ea8ee6193c02684193ec925da:0

value
2969641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e635d17de21a4eb92193da1ae2c5dd890bd34b OP_EQUAL
address
3QewJyomQMKkNx7wgposn4fwzdGYuWzbda
transaction
e07ef14e183b3017a6491b064fe64ece186ebe1ea8ee6193c02684193ec925da
spent
true